We provide mental health therapy in Westminster, MD and virtually throughout Maryland for individuals who are in recovery or working through addiction-related challenges.

We are not an addiction treatment provider; however, our therapists are experienced in supporting clients through the emotional and mental health aspects that often accompany recovery. This may include addressing underlying concerns, building coping skills, and strengthening emotional regulation.


When appropriate, we can coordinate care with specialized addiction treatment programs or other providers to support a comprehensive approach.


Our work is individualized and centered around your goals, stage of recovery, and overall well-being.
